Luna is a 5 year old, 14 pound, female Shih Tzu/Poodle mix. She came into rescue because her owners couldnt devote the necessary time that she needs.
Luna is an active dog who needs exercise every day. She walks over a mile a day, enjoying all the sniffs and smells, and greeting other dogs and people. She runs outside to chase the resident rabbits and squirrels around the yard. It would be ideal for Luna to have a fenced yard, but it is not absolutely required, as long as her new family will provide the daily activity she needs. When inside, she will play fetch with a ball and her other toys.
Luna is well behaved and enjoys being around her foster parents and other people and doesnt venture outside by herself unless one of her foster parents is with her. She is just a very sweet, affectionate dog who just loves to be with her people, especially sitting on their lap.
Luna needs to have someone at home the majority of the day. She is good around other dogs and would be a wonderful addition to a family with older, respectful children, where she would be the beloved family dog. She is very alert and will bark when someone is at the door or if she hears a noise outside, so it would be best if she lives in a single family home rather than a condo or townhouse with shared walls.
Luna is housetrained, and currently sleeps either in her own bed or under her foster parents bed. Her foster family is not sure why she does this but would love for her to sleep with them in their bed. Hopefully her new family will encourage her to sleep with them as well. She knows basic commands such as sit, down, stay, and come (especially for a treat).
As mentioned above, Luna must have a family in which someone is home most of the day. She does have some separation anxiety, which her foster parents are working with her to overcome. Her new family must understand this and continue to help Luna feel more secure and confident when she is left alone. In addition, she whines while riding in the back seat of the car, but probably just wants to ride in the front with her people.
